Manipal Health Enterprises Lists at 11% Premium, Strong Market Debut on BSE
Manipal Health Enterprises made a strong market debut on Wednesday, listing at an 11 per cent premium to the issue price on the BSE, with its stock trading at ₹651 level.

The stock began trading at ₹655 against the IPO price of ₹590 on the BSE, while on the NSE, it listed at ₹652, up 10.5 per cent.
The stock later moderated to trade between ₹635 and ₹662 and was at around ₹651 at the time of writing.
Market Experts Weigh in on the Listing
Shivani Nyati, Head of Wealth at Swastika Investmart, said Manipal Health Enterprises’ 11 per cent listing premium reflected healthy investor demand, but added that the stock is trading at a premium valuation with limited margin of safety.
She advised allotted investors to continue holding the stock, while fresh investors should wait for better entry levels or further debt reduction before buying.
Nyati also advised maintaining a stop-loss at ₹620 to protect listing gains.
Market Impact and Details
- The company’s ₹9,275 crore initial public offering was subscribed 4.92 times overall.
- The issue received bids for 44,30,73,025 shares against 9,00,88,286 shares on offer, according to NSE data.
- The qualified institutional buyers’ portion was subscribed 8.25 times, while the non-institutional investors’ category was subscribed 1.02 times.
- The retail investors’ portion was subscribed 93 per cent.
- Ahead of the IPO, Manipal Health raised ₹4,167 crore from anchor investors, including Abu Dhabi Investment Authority and Allianz Global Investors Fund.

- The company plans to use ₹5,378 crore from the fresh issue to repay or prepay borrowings of its subsidiary, Manipal Hospitals Pvt. Ltd.
- The company operates a pan-India network of multispecialty hospitals offering services ranging from outpatient care to tertiary and quaternary interventions.
